The Encyclopedia of Grasses for Livable Landscapes
text and photographs by Rick Darke
In this new book noted grass expert and advocate Rick Darke addresses both the aesthetic qualities of grasses in private gardens and the opportunities and challenges of using them in wild and constructed public landscapes. More than 1,000 stunning photographs show details of individual grasses and hundreds of gardens and landscapes in which grasses play a prominent part. This encyclopedia is an authoritative design reference that sets a new standard for inspired, sustainable use of grasses.
“The massive plant encyclopedia describes hundreds of different grasses...with specifics to help gardeners select the most appropriate grasses for their conditions and help nurseries decide which ones to stock." —Los Angeles Times
